LAGOS, Nigeria (VOICE OF NAIJA) Emiliano Martinez, Aston Villa goalkeeper, lauded his fellow Argentina teammate, Lionel Messi, as the unparalleled embodiment of football accomplishment.
Martinez expressed his deep admiration for Messi, highlighting his remarkable impact on the pitch and off it.
With Argentina’s victory in the 2022 World Cup, Messi has now clinched every major trophy in both club and international football, making him, in Martinez’s view, the sole player in history to have “completed football.”
In an interview with TV Publica, Martinez remarked, “He embodies the quintessential Argentine.

“He’s a family man who devotes himself to his children and wife. He’s passionate about football, leaving nothing behind on the field.
“Messi sets the standard, and he’s probably the most globally renowned player.
The way he cherishes his family and nurtures his children is a source of pride.”
Martinez further elaborated, “I closely follow his example in this regard. He is the first and only player in history to have achieved the entirety of football.
“He concludes his career not just as an icon on the pitch but also as a person. I don’t need to tell him these things because he is well aware.
“He knows the extent of my admiration for him and how I support him on the field.”
Additionally, the 31-year-old goalkeeper shared a peculiar pre-final ritual he followed before the match against France on December 18, 2022.
He revealed, “The night before, I managed to sleep soundly. I always sleep well before games.
“On the day of the final, I took a three-hour nap. My pre-match snack was a ham and cheese sandwich, along with mate con mate.”
The reigning world champions’ next fixture will occur on October 12 when they face Paraguay in a 2026 World Cup qualifying match.
